Wodginite is a manganese, tin, tantalum oxide mineral with the chemical formula Mn2+(Sn,Ta)Ta
2
O
8
. It may also include significant amounts of niobium.[1][2]

Background

Wodginite was first described in 1963 for an occurrence in the Wodgina pegmatite, Wodgina, Pilbara Region, Western Australia.[3]

Typical occurrence of wodginite occurs in zoned pegmatites in amphibolite. It is associated with tantalite, albite, quartz, muscovite, tapiolite, microlite and microcline.[1]

It occurs in pegmatites in a wide variety of locations. The most studied is the Tanco pegmatite in Manitoba, Canada ; also in Red Lake, Ontario. It is reported from the Strickland quarry, Portland, Middlesex County, Connecticut; the Herbb #2 pegmatite, Powhatan County, Virginia; the McAllister mine, Rockford, Coosa County, Alabama; the Peerless mine, Pennington County, South Dakota. Also from Paraíba and Minas Gerais, Brazil ; Krasonice, Czech Republic; Orivesi, Finland ; Kalba, eastern Kazakhstan; Ankole, Uganda; Miami district, Zimbabwe and Karibib and Kohero, Namibia.[1][3]
